草庐IT

php - Bcrypt 在 Lumen 5.4 : Call to undefined function bcrypt() 中不工作

我创建了一个新的Lumen5.4项目并尝试播种一些数据。在播种机中,我使用bcrypt来散列密码。但是当我运行phpartisandb:seed时,我得到了这个错误:Calltoundefinedfunctionbcrypt()为什么我不能在Lumen中使用bcrypt?我以前在Laravel中使用过它。 最佳答案 你可以试试:app('hash')->make('yourpassword'); 关于php-Bcrypt在Lumen5.4:Calltoundefinedfunctionb

php - 刚刚安装了 Lumen 并得到了 NotFoundHttpException

我正在寻找解决方案……它变得如此令人沮丧。通过Laravel全新安装Lumen后,我根本无法访问“/”路由。当我尝试时,它会抛出一个错误:NotFoundHttpExceptioninRoutesRequests.phpline443:inRoutesRequests.phpline443atApplication->handleDispatcherResponse(array('0'))inRoutesRequests.phpline380atApplication->Laravel\Lumen\Concerns\{closure}()inRoutesRequests.phpline

php - 刚刚安装了 Lumen 并得到了 NotFoundHttpException

我正在寻找解决方案……它变得如此令人沮丧。通过Laravel全新安装Lumen后,我根本无法访问“/”路由。当我尝试时,它会抛出一个错误:NotFoundHttpExceptioninRoutesRequests.phpline443:inRoutesRequests.phpline443atApplication->handleDispatcherResponse(array('0'))inRoutesRequests.phpline380atApplication->Laravel\Lumen\Concerns\{closure}()inRoutesRequests.phpline

php - 安装后在 Lumen 中找不到页面

这个问题在这里已经有了答案:NotFoundHttpExceptionwithLumen(2个答案)关闭7年前。我刚刚安装了Lumen但是当我前往它的公共(public)目录localhost/lumen/public时,Sorry,thepageyouarelookingforcouldnotbefound.会出现。我检查了app\Http\routes.php并更改了$app->get('/',function()use($app){到$app->get('/lumen/public/',function()use($app){它奏效了。但这不是我想要的。在Laravel中,'/'

php - 安装后在 Lumen 中找不到页面

这个问题在这里已经有了答案:NotFoundHttpExceptionwithLumen(2个答案)关闭7年前。我刚刚安装了Lumen但是当我前往它的公共(public)目录localhost/lumen/public时,Sorry,thepageyouarelookingforcouldnotbefound.会出现。我检查了app\Http\routes.php并更改了$app->get('/',function()use($app){到$app->get('/lumen/public/',function()use($app){它奏效了。但这不是我想要的。在Laravel中,'/'

php - 基于 token 的身份验证中的 session

我正在用PHPLumen构建一个应用程序,它在登录时返回一个token。我不确定如何继续进行。我应该如何使用这些token维护session?具体来说,如果我使用的是reactjs或vanillaHTML/CSS/jQuery,我该如何在客户端存储token并在我为网络应用程序的安全部分发出的每个请求中发送它们? 最佳答案 我通常做的是将token保存在本地存储中,这样即使用户离开站点,我也可以保留token。localStorage.setItem('app-token',theTokenFromServer);每次用户加载页面时

php - 基于 token 的身份验证中的 session

我正在用PHPLumen构建一个应用程序,它在登录时返回一个token。我不确定如何继续进行。我应该如何使用这些token维护session?具体来说,如果我使用的是reactjs或vanillaHTML/CSS/jQuery,我该如何在客户端存储token并在我为网络应用程序的安全部分发出的每个请求中发送它们? 最佳答案 我通常做的是将token保存在本地存储中,这样即使用户离开站点,我也可以保留token。localStorage.setItem('app-token',theTokenFromServer);每次用户加载页面时

php - Lumen:在 Blade View 中获取 URL 参数

我正在尝试从View文件中获取url参数。我有这个网址:http://locahost:8000/example?a=10和一个名为example.blade.php的View文件。从Controller中,我可以使用$request->input('a')获取参数a。有没有办法从View中获取此类参数(无需将其从Controller传递到View)? 最佳答案 这很好用:{{app('request')->input('a')}}其中a是url参数。在这里查看更多信息:http://blog.netgloo.com/2015/07

php - Lumen:在 Blade View 中获取 URL 参数

我正在尝试从View文件中获取url参数。我有这个网址:http://locahost:8000/example?a=10和一个名为example.blade.php的View文件。从Controller中,我可以使用$request->input('a')获取参数a。有没有办法从View中获取此类参数(无需将其从Controller传递到View)? 最佳答案 这很好用:{{app('request')->input('a')}}其中a是url参数。在这里查看更多信息:http://blog.netgloo.com/2015/07

UE5中启用Lumen全局光照的方法

UE5中启用Lumen全局光照的方法项目设置打开项目设置-渲染-把动态全局光照方法和反射方法都设置为Lumen(见图一)调整软件光线追踪模式-细节追踪/全局追踪(见图二)细节追踪:可以追踪每个网格体的距离场,进行更高品质的渲染,需要更多的性能(适用于小场景)全局追踪:快速追踪全局的距离场,品质没有细节追踪高,节省性能(适用于大场景)开启硬件追踪的方法(见图三)点击“支持硬件光线追踪”-在开启使用硬件光线追踪(硬件追踪可以追踪的几何体更多,性能开销最大)阴影(见图四)阴影贴图:效果低于虚拟阴影贴图,阴影效果有狗牙感虚拟阴影贴图:阴影效果更精细,提升阴影分辨率,性能开销增加(建议开启)开启网格体距